Does Belfast Zoo Have Pandas. Belfast zoo has confirmed that an endangered red panda which had been reported missing has now been found safe and well. A rare red panda at large from belfast zoo was believed to be taking in the sights of beautiful glengormley before being tracked down. The escape of a rare red panda from belfast zoo almost two years ago made headlines across the uk. Thankfully, the cub called amber was found safe and well and returned to her family.
